当JavaScript无法访问由PHP动态生成的DOM元素时,常见原因在于文件扩展名不正确。
例如,限制一次最多上传5个文件: files := r.MultipartForm.File["uploadFiles"] if len(files) > 5 { http.Error(w, "最多上传5个文件", http.StatusBadRequest) return } 再结合循环对每个文件做大小和类型检查。
使用std::find进行线性查找,适用于小规模或无序数据,时间复杂度O(n);2. 排序后使用std::binary_search,适合多次查找且允许排序的场景,时间复杂度O(log n);3. 使用std::unordered_set或std::unordered_map实现平均O(1)查找,适合频繁查询;4. 值域较小时可用辅助数组映射索引,实现O(1)定位,但需注意内存消耗。
根据项目需求和预算选择合适的CDN。
基本上就这些。
假设我们只关心'A', 'B', 'C', 'D'这几个QuantityMeasured类别。
errors.Is(err, target error): 这个函数会遍历错误链条,检查链条中的任何一个错误是否与 target 错误“等价”。
这里使用类型断言将 []byte 类型转换为 string 类型。
使用建议:在编码过程中需要快速确认某个函数用法时,命令行godoc是最直接高效的选择。
Go语言中的encoding/gob包用于对Go对象进行高效的序列化和反序列化,适合在Go程序之间传输或存储数据。
立即学习“PHP免费学习笔记(深入)”; 以下是实现这一逻辑的优化代码示例: 无阶未来模型擂台/AI 应用平台 无阶未来模型擂台/AI 应用平台,一站式模型+应用平台 35 查看详情 <?php // 1. 设置时区:根据实际业务需求,明确指定操作的时区。
建议根据实际负载测试调整: 小规模服务可从10~100开始尝试 高吞吐场景可通过压测找到吞吐量稳定且内存可控的值 监控channel长度变化,避免长期积压 结合select语句使用default分支,可在channel满时执行降级逻辑(如丢弃、重试或告警),增强系统健壮性。
编写可维护的测试用例 高质量的测试代码应具备清晰结构和高可读性: 立即学习“PHP免费学习笔记(深入)”; 青柚面试 简单好用的日语面试辅助工具 57 查看详情 遵循“Arrange-Act-Assert”模式组织测试流程,便于理解每个步骤。
答案是用Golang开发基础投票统计工具需定义候选人和选票结构体,通过map累计票数,遍历选票完成计票,并在main函数中初始化数据、调用计票函数并输出结果。
Find JSON Path Online Easily find JSON paths within JSON objects using our intuitive Json Path Finder 30 查看详情 逐步断言: 对于多层嵌套的结构,不要试图一次性进行深层断言。
范围for不适用于部分遍历(如跳过首尾),此时需传统或迭代器方式。
PHP版本兼容性: 确保您的PHP版本与OpenCart 3.0兼容,并且所有必要的PHP扩展(如openssl用于SSL/TLS连接)都已启用。
它在调用时就将值复制到语句中,后续变量值的改变不会影响已绑定的参数。
代码可读性: 使用有意义的变量名,添加注释,并遵循良好的代码风格,可以提高代码的可读性和可维护性。
文章解释了为何直接使用 map[string]string 作为匿名成员会导致编译错误,以及如何通过定义类型别名来规避此问题。
本文链接:http://www.altodescuento.com/340528_1610cb.html